1959 Morgan 4 vs. 1970 Nissan Cedric

To start off, 1970 Nissan Cedric is newer by 11 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1959 Morgan 4.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1959 Morgan 4 would be higher. At 1,998 cc (4 cylinders), 1970 Nissan Cedric is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1970 Nissan Cedric (114 HP @ 5200 RPM) has 81 more horse power than 1959 Morgan 4. (33 HP @ 4500 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1970 Nissan Cedric should accelerate faster than 1959 Morgan 4.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1970 Nissan Cedric weights approximately 640 kg more than 1959 Morgan 4.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Let's talk about torque, 1970 Nissan Cedric (165 Nm @ 4400 RPM) has 92 more torque (in Nm) than 1959 Morgan 4. (73 Nm @ 2100 RPM). This means 1970 Nissan Cedric will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1959 Morgan 4.

Compare all specifications:

1959 Morgan 4 1970 Nissan Cedric
Make Morgan Nissan
Model 4 Cedric
Year Released 1959 1970
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1172 cc 1998 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 33 HP 114 HP
Engine RPM 4500 RPM 5200 RPM
Torque 73 Nm 165 Nm
Torque RPM 2100 RPM 4400 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Vehicle Weight 650 kg 1290 kg
Vehicle Length 3670 mm 4700 mm
Vehicle Width 1430 mm 1700 mm
Vehicle Height 1300 mm 1470 mm
Wheelbase Size 2450 mm 2700 mm
